Computer Arithmetic and Formal Proofs

Computer Arithmetic and Formal Proofs
Author :
Publisher : Elsevier
Total Pages : 328
Release :
ISBN-10 : 9780081011706
ISBN-13 : 0081011709
Rating : 4/5 (709 Downloads)

Book Synopsis Computer Arithmetic and Formal Proofs by : Sylvie Boldo

Download or read book Computer Arithmetic and Formal Proofs written by Sylvie Boldo and published by Elsevier. This book was released on 2017-11-17 with total page 328 pages. Available in PDF, EPUB and Kindle. Book excerpt: Floating-point arithmetic is ubiquitous in modern computing, as it is the tool of choice to approximate real numbers. Due to its limited range and precision, its use can become quite involved and potentially lead to numerous failures. One way to greatly increase confidence in floating-point software is by computer-assisted verification of its correctness proofs. This book provides a comprehensive view of how to formally specify and verify tricky floating-point algorithms with the Coq proof assistant. It describes the Flocq formalization of floating-point arithmetic and some methods to automate theorem proofs. It then presents the specification and verification of various algorithms, from error-free transformations to a numerical scheme for a partial differential equation. The examples cover not only mathematical algorithms but also C programs as well as issues related to compilation. Describes the notions of specification and weakest precondition computation and their practical use Shows how to tackle algorithms that extend beyond the realm of simple floating-point arithmetic Includes real analysis and a case study about numerical analysis


Computer Arithmetic and Formal Proofs Related Books

Computer Arithmetic and Formal Proofs
Language: en
Pages: 328
Authors: Sylvie Boldo
Categories: Computers
Type: BOOK - Published: 2017-11-17 - Publisher: Elsevier

DOWNLOAD EBOOK

Floating-point arithmetic is ubiquitous in modern computing, as it is the tool of choice to approximate real numbers. Due to its limited range and precision, it
Proof and Disproof in Formal Logic
Language: en
Pages: 264
Authors: Richard Bornat
Categories: Mathematics
Type: BOOK - Published: 2005-07-21 - Publisher: OUP Oxford

DOWNLOAD EBOOK

Proof and Disproof in Formal Logic is a lively and entertaining introduction to formal logic providing an excellent insight into how a simple logic works. Forma
Proofs and Computations
Language: en
Pages: 480
Authors: Helmut Schwichtenberg
Categories: Mathematics
Type: BOOK - Published: 2011-12-15 - Publisher: Cambridge University Press

DOWNLOAD EBOOK

Driven by the question, 'What is the computational content of a (formal) proof?', this book studies fundamental interactions between proof theory and computabil
Concepts of Proof in Mathematics, Philosophy, and Computer Science
Language: en
Pages: 392
Authors: Dieter Probst
Categories: Philosophy
Type: BOOK - Published: 2016-07-25 - Publisher: Walter de Gruyter GmbH & Co KG

DOWNLOAD EBOOK

A proof is a successful demonstration that a conclusion necessarily follows by logical reasoning from axioms which are considered evident for the given context
Computer Assisted Proof
Language: en
Pages: 111
Authors: Fouad Sabry
Categories: Computers
Type: BOOK - Published: 2023-07-06 - Publisher: One Billion Knowledgeable

DOWNLOAD EBOOK

What Is Computer Assisted Proof A mathematical proof is considered to be computer-assisted if it has been generated by the computer in some way, even if just in